Subject: [PATCH v2 3/3] KVM: arm64: Perform memory fault exits when stage-2 handler EFAULTs
Date: Fri, 9 Aug 2024 20:51:58 +0000 [thread overview]
Message-ID: <20240809205158.1340255-4-amoorthy@google.com>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<20240809205158.1340255-1-amoorthy@google.com>
Right now userspace just gets a bare EFAULT when the stage-2 fault
handler fails to fault in the relevant page. Set up a
KVM_EXIT_MEMORY_FAULT whenever this happens, which at the very least
eases debugging and might also let userspace decide on/take some
specific action other than crashing the VM.
In some cases, user_mem_abort() EFAULTs before the size of the fault is
calculated: return 0 in these cases to indicate that the fault is of
unknown size.

Documentation/virt/kvm/api.rst | 2 +-
arch/arm64/kvm/arm.c | 1 +
arch/arm64/kvm/mmu.c | 11 ++++++++++-
3 files changed, 12 insertions(+), 2 deletions(-)
diff --git a/Documentation/virt/kvm/api.rst b/Documentation/virt/kvm/api.rst
index c5ce7944005c..7b321fefcb3e 100644
--- a/Documentation/virt/kvm/api.rst
+++ b/Documentation/virt/kvm/api.rst
@@ -8129,7 +8129,7 @@ unavailable to host or other VMs.
7.34 KVM_CAP_MEMORY_FAULT_INFO
------------------------------
-:Architectures: x86
+:Architectures: arm64, x86
:Returns: Informational only, -EINVAL on direct KVM_ENABLE_CAP.
The presence of this capability indicates that KVM_RUN *may* fill
diff --git a/arch/arm64/kvm/arm.c b/arch/arm64/kvm/arm.c
index a7ca776b51ec..4121b5a43b9c 100644
--- a/arch/arm64/kvm/arm.c
+++ b/arch/arm64/kvm/arm.c
@@ -335,6 +335,7 @@ int kvm_vm_ioctl_check_extension(struct kvm *kvm, long ext)
case KVM_CAP_ARM_SYSTEM_SUSPEND:
case KVM_CAP_IRQFD_RESAMPLE:
case KVM_CAP_COUNTER_OFFSET:
+ case KVM_CAP_MEMORY_FAULT_INFO:
r = 1;
break;
case KVM_CAP_SET_GUEST_DEBUG2:
diff --git a/arch/arm64/kvm/mmu.c b/arch/arm64/kvm/mmu.c
index 6981b1bc0946..c97199d1feac 100644
--- a/arch/arm64/kvm/mmu.c
+++ b/arch/arm64/kvm/mmu.c
@@ -1448,6 +1448,8 @@ static int user_mem_abort(struct kvm_vcpu *vcpu, phys_addr_t fault_ipa,
if (fault_is_perm && !write_fault && !exec_fault) {
kvm_err("Unexpected L2 read permission error\n");
+ kvm_prepare_memory_fault_exit(vcpu, fault_ipa, 0,
+ write_fault, exec_fault, false);
return -EFAULT;
}
@@ -1473,6 +1475,8 @@ static int user_mem_abort(struct kvm_vcpu *vcpu, phys_addr_t fault_ipa,
if (unlikely(!vma)) {
kvm_err("Failed to find VMA for hva 0x%lx\n", hva);
mmap_read_unlock(current->mm);
+ kvm_prepare_memory_fault_exit(vcpu, fault_ipa, 0,
+ write_fault, exec_fault, false);
return -EFAULT;
}
@@ -1568,8 +1572,11 @@ static int user_mem_abort(struct kvm_vcpu *vcpu, phys_addr_t fault_ipa,
kvm_send_hwpoison_signal(hva, vma_shift);
return 0;
}
- if (is_error_noslot_pfn(pfn))
+ if (is_error_noslot_pfn(pfn)) {
+ kvm_prepare_memory_fault_exit(vcpu, fault_ipa, vma_pagesize,
+ write_fault, exec_fault, false);
return -EFAULT;
+ }
if (kvm_is_device_pfn(pfn)) {
/*
@@ -1643,6 +1650,8 @@ static int user_mem_abort(struct kvm_vcpu *vcpu, phys_addr_t fault_ipa,
if (mte_allowed) {
sanitise_mte_tags(kvm, pfn, vma_pagesize);
} else {
+ kvm_prepare_memory_fault_exit(vcpu, fault_ipa, vma_pagesize,
+ write_fault, exec_fault, false);
ret = -EFAULT;
goto out_unlock;
}
